Product Information
Johnsonville Mild Sandwich Size Breakfast Sausage Patties are about 2 ounces and 3.3 inches in diameter. There are six patties per tray. This is a tray wrapped, frozen product.
- 6 fresh Breakfast Sausage Patties
- Do breakfast right with sausage patties perfectly sized to fit your breakfast bread
- Made with 100% Premium cuts of Pork and a perfect blend of spices, no artificial colors or flavors.
- Perfect for a hearty, full breakfast before school or work
- Excellent source of protein - 8g of per serving
- Air Fry at 390°F in single layer, 5-6 minutes until sausage is browned and internal temperature is 160°F, turning patties once
- Cook in skillet 10-12 minutes over medium heat until sausage is browned and internal temperature is 160°F, turning sausage often
- Gluten Free
